Nicknamed the heel of Italy, Puglia in the warm south offers a laid-back charm with its sun-soaked landscape. This region is scattered with fortified castles, iconic whitewashed trulli—Puglia’s signature cone-shaped dwellings—and is blanketed by ancient olive groves shimmering like silver. Puglia boasts an incredibly rich bounty of natural produce, being the primary source of Italy’s extra virgin olive oil and renowned for its robust wines, flavorful olives, almonds, and figs. Local delicacies include orecchiette pasta, seafood risotto, fava beans, and the rich, creamy burrata cheese. You’ll be well-fed during your painting holiday sessions here in Puglia.

Inspiring sights for your artistic eye include the turquoise waters and long sandy beaches, the 13th-century Swabian castle, Lecce’s Baroque churches, the panoramic hillside views from Specchia, and the awe-inspiring mosaic floor at Otranto Cathedral, created by a 12th-century monk. The accomodation, Villa Ortelle, is a stunning masseria nestled in the heart of Ortelle and steeped in tradition and history. Once a 19th-century farmhouse, it has been beautifully restored in recent years, blending traditional and modern elements into a perfect retreat. The garden is adorned with Mediterranean plants and flowers, with the characteristic Lecce stone as its central feature, creating an oasis for relaxation.
